Claims
- 1. A stabilized radiation switch for a flashlamp unit and capable of changing from a high electrical resistance to a low electrical resistance when exposed to the radiation emitted from a flashlamp disposed adjacent to the switch, said switch comprising a mass of switch material adapted to be innerconnected to a pair of spaced apart electrical terminals, said switch material comprising a silver compound having a high electrical resistance, a humidity resistant organic polymer binder, and a small amount by weight of a weakly acidic organic compound which reacts with silver ions to form a water insoluble reaction product which inhibits water from substantially reducing the high electrical resistance of said silver compound.
- 2. A radiation switch as in claim 1 wherein the switch material contains about 0.1 - 2.0 weight percent of said organic compound.
- 3. A radiation switch as in claim 1 wherein the switch material further contains up to approximately 4.0 weight percent of a non-ionic surfactant.
- 4. A radiation switch as in claim 1 wherein the organic compound is an aromatic triazole compound selected from the group consisting of benzotriazole and carbon substituted benzotriazoles.
- 5. A radiation switch as in claim 2 wherein said organic compound is benzotriazole.

A radiation switch as in claim 1 wherein said silver compound is in the form of particles which are adhesively bonded together by said humidity resistant organic polymer binder, and said particles being coated with a water insoluble coating formed by reacting the surface layer of said particles with said organic compound.
- 7. A radiation switch as in claim 6 wherein the switch material contains up to approximately 4.0 weight percent of a non-ionic surfactant.
- 8. A radiation switch as in claim 7 wherein the organic compound is an aromatic triazole compound selected from the group of benzotriazole and carbon substituted benzotriazoles.
- 9. A radiation switch as in claim 7 wherein the organic compound is benzotriazole.

A switch convertible by radiation from a photoflash lamp from a high resistance state to a relatively low resistance state and stabilized against adverse effects from high humidity and temperature, said switch comprising a mass of material adapted to be interconnected between spaced electrical terminals, and wherein said material includes (a) a silver compound having a high electrical resistance, (b) a humidity resistant organic polymer binder, and (c) a small amount by weight of an organic compound, said organic compound having a molecular structure which includes (i) a triazole ring having a hydrogen atom attached to one of the nitrogen atoms, and (ii) a hydrocarbon moiety.

A radiation switch convertible by radiation from a photoflash lamp from a high resistance state to a relatively low resistance state and stabilized against adverse effects from high humidity and temperature, said switch comprising a mass of switch material innerconnected to a pair of spaced apart electrical terminals, and wherein said switch material comprises a mixture of silver oxide and a carbon-containing silver salt, a substantially water insoluble organic polymer binder, and a small amount by weight of an aromatic triazole compound selected from the group consisting of benzotriazole and carbon substituted benzotriazoles.
- 12. A radiation switch as in claim 11 in which said switch material contains about 0.1 - 2.0 weight of said aromatic triazole compound and in which said organic compound is benzotriazole.
- 13. A radiation switch as in claim 12 in which said binder consists essentially of ethyl hydroxyethyl cellulose.
- 14. A photoflash lamp unit comprising
- a. a pair of flashlamps
- b. an electrical circuit into which said lamps are arranged to flash individually and in sequence, and
- c. a solid state radiation energy switch device located external of the flashlamps and forming part of the electrical circuit, said switch device being located adjacent one of said flashlamps and disposed to receive radiant energy emitted by that flashlamp, said photoflash lamp unit being characterized by said switch device being a high relative humidity resistant mass of switch material innerconnected to a pair of spaced apart electrical terminals in the electrical circuit, said switch material comprising a silver compound having a high electrical resistance, a humidity resistant organic polymer binder, and a small amount by weight of a weakly acidic organic compound which reacts with silver ions to form a water-insoluble reaction product which inhibits water from substantially reducing the high electrical resistance of said silver compound.
